  • Patent number: 5335700
    Abstract: A weft picking system for an air jet loom provided with a microcomputer as a controller. The weft picking system comprises a weft traction device including a pair of rollers one of which is driven by an inverter motor. A weft yarn fed from a weft measuring and storing device can be put between the rollers to be drawn toward a weft posture regulating nozzle. The weft posture regulating nozzle is arranged to project the weft yarn into the shed of warp yarns while regulating the posture of the weft yarn, under the influence of an air jet ejected therefrom and under assistance of air ejection from a plurality of sub-nozzles. The rollers are always driven to rotate during a weaving operation of the loom. A change-over device is provided to change the weft yarn from a first state of being put between the rollers to a second state of separating from the rollers or vice versa.

  • Patent number: 4967806
    Abstract: A weft picking control system for accomplishing weft picking in a high response throughout a wide region of operating conditions of an air jet loom. The loom has a weft inserting nozzle which projects a weft yarn under the influence of air ejection therefrom. The weft picking control system has a first device for detecting a weft reaching timing at which the weft yarn projected from the weft inserting nozzle reaches a counter-weft picking side. A second device is provided to control an effective air ejection time for weft picking depending upon the air ejection of the weft inserting nozzle, in accordance with the detected weft reaching timing. The effective air ejection time is defined by at least one of a pawl disengagement timing (at which a weft retaining pawl is disengaged from a drum of a weft measuring and storing unit) and an air ejection termination timing (at which air ejection from the weft inserting nozzle is terminated).

  • Patent number: 4942908
    Abstract: A warp transfer control system for a loom, includes a first actuator for varying a warp let-off speed, a second actuator for varying a fabric take-up speed to change a filling density, and a control unit which has a take-up control section for controlling the second actuator, a feedback control section for controlling the let-off speed through the first actuator when no change is required in the filling density, and a feedforward control section for changing the let-off speed so as to improve an appearance quality of a fabric when the density is changed. When a change from a first filling density to a second density is required, the feedforward section first changes the let-off speed excessively from a first let-off speed corresponding to the first density beyond a second let-off speed corresponding to the second density, and holds the let-off speed at such an excessive level for a limited duration.

  • Patent number: 4572244
    Abstract: A loom having left and right warp beams and a common tension roller is provided with an electric or mechanical control system, which detects forces exerted on left and right supports of the tension roller by the warp threads of both warp beams, and produces a left control signal corresponding to a tension of the warp threads of the left warp beam and a right control signal corresponding to a tension of the warp threads of the right warp beam in accordance with the detected forces. The rotational speeds of the left and right warp beams are controlled individually in accordance with the left and right control signals, respectively.

  • Patent number: 4480665
    Abstract: A weft-bar (set mark) prevention system for a loom which can prevent a weft-bar caused when the loom is immediately restarted, after the loom has been stopped due to weft- or warp-thread cut (i.e., breakage of a weft or warp thread). When the loom is restarted from the closed-shed state, a greater additional warp tension is applied to the warp threads; when the loom is started from the open-shed state, a smaller additional warp tension is applied to the warp threads. After one or two cycles of the loom motion, the above-mentioned additional warp tensions are not applied, because the main motor is in a stable condition. The system according to the present invention comprises an optical loom-starting angle sensor for detecting whether the loom is started from the closed-shed or open-shed, a counter for determining at least one initial cycle during which warp tension is controlled, air cylinder to push the easing lever in the direction to increase warp tension.
